Maintaining comfortable indoor temperatures in Islip Terrace can be uniquely challenging due to the area’s seasonal climate shifts and high humidity levels. Summers often bring muggy heat, requiring robust air conditioning systems, while winters call for reliable heating solutions to combat brisk coastal winds. These fluctuating demands make it crucial for homeowners to have HVAC systems that are both energy-efficient and capable of handling the region’s weather extremes. With many homes in neighborhoods like Brookwood Estates and the areas surrounding Lowell Avenue School featuring older ductwork, upgrading or servicing these systems often requires additional attention to airflow and energy efficiency.
Another factor to consider in Islip Terrace is compliance with local building codes and energy standards. The Town of Islip Building Division enforces regulations that include duct leakage testing, SEER rating requirements for air conditioners, and proper zoning for outdoor condenser units, all of which aim to improve energy efficiency and system performance. Homeowners often need expert guidance to navigate these requirements during HVAC installations or replacements. Costs for a full HVAC replacement in the area typically range from $8,000 to $18,000, depending on the system size and the complexity of the home’s layout.
